How Our Team Handles Warehouse Water Damage Restoration

When you’ve got a Warehouse Water Damage Restoration emergency on your hands, every minute counts. That’s why we’ve developed a step-by-step process to get your property back in shape as quickly as possible. Here’s how it works:

Step 1: Assessment and Inspection

Our team will arrive on-site within 60 minutes of your call to assess the damage and identify the source of the water. We’ll use advanced equipment to detect hidden moisture and identify potential hazards.

Step 2: Water Extraction and Removal

We’ll use high-powered pumps and advanced extraction equipment to remove standing water from your property. This helps prevent further damage and reduces the risk of mold and mildew growth.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Next, we’ll use industrial-grade drying equipment to remove moisture from your property. This includes air movers and dehumidifiers that work together to dry your property quickly and efficiently.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Decontamination

Finally, we’ll use disinfectants and decontamination agents to sanitize your property and prevent the growth of mold and mildew.

Warehouse Water Damage Restoration Cost in Roland, IA

The cost of Warehouse Water Damage Rest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Roland, IA. Here are some estimates to give you an idea of what to expect: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Removal $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Type of equipment needed, duration of drying process
Sanitizing and Decontamination $500 – $2,000 Type of sanitizing agents needed, extent of contamination
Repair and Re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 Extent of damage, type of materials needed
Emergency Service Fee $100 – $500 Time of day, urgency of situation

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ment by our team. Free estimates are available for all services.
